.elementor-9 .elementor-element.elementor-element-d2c1d4c >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:flex-start;align-items:flex-start;}.elementor-9 .elementor-element.elementor-element-d2c1d4c{padding:0px 0px 0px 0px;}.elementor-bc-flex-widget .elementor-9 .elementor-element.elementor-element-2c40e02.elementor-column .elementor-widget-wrap{align-items:flex-start;}.elementor-9 .elementor-element.elementor-element-2c40e02.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:flex-start;align-items:flex-start;}.elementor-9 .elementor-element.elementor-element-2c40e02.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-9 .elementor-element.elementor-element-2c40e02: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-9 .elementor-element.elementor-element-2c40e02 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#070707;}.elementor-9 .elementor-element.elementor-element-2c40e02 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:0rem 0rem 0rem 0rem;--e-column-margin-right:0rem;--e-column-margin-left:0rem;padding:125px 0px 150px 75px;}.elementor-9 .elementor-element.elementor-element-2c40e02 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-9 .elementor-element.elementor-element-c3fcf27{text-align:center;width:auto;max-width:auto;}.elementor-9 .elementor-element.elementor-element-c3fcf27 .elementor-heading-title{font-family:"Bai Jamjuree", Sans-serif;font-weight:400;}.elementor-9 .elementor-element.elementor-element-53da6b7{--spacer-size:15px;}.elementor-9 .elementor-element.elementor-element-69df920{width:var( --container-widget-width, 450px );max-width:450px;--container-widget-width:450px;--container-widget-flex-grow:0;}.elementor-9 .elementor-element.elementor-element-ad32e9f{width:var( --container-widget-width, 450px );max-width:450px;--container-widget-width:450px;--container-widget-flex-grow:0;}.elementor-bc-flex-widget .elementor-9 .elementor-element.elementor-element-4d51bb2.elementor-column .elementor-widget-wrap{align-items:flex-start;}.elementor-9 .elementor-element.elementor-element-4d51bb2.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:flex-start;align-items:flex-start;}.elementor-9 .elementor-element.elementor-element-4d51bb2.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-9 .elementor-element.elementor-element-4d51bb2: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-9 .elementor-element.elementor-element-4d51bb2 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#050505;}.elementor-9 .elementor-element.elementor-element-4d51bb2 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:125px 0px 150px 0px;}.elementor-9 .elementor-element.elementor-element-4d51bb2 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-9 .elementor-element.elementor-element-70c933d .elementor-heading-title{font-family:"Bai Jamjuree", Sans-serif;font-weight:400;}.elementor-9 .elementor-element.elementor-element-70c933d > .elementor-widget-container{margin:-5px 0px 0px 0px;}.elementor-9 .elementor-element.elementor-element-70c933d{width:var( --container-widget-width, 36vw );max-width:36vw;--container-widget-width:36vw;--container-widget-flex-grow:0;}.elementor-9 .elementor-element.elementor-element-43009cf{--spacer-size:50px;}.elementor-9 .elementor-element.elementor-element-0e20012{font-family:"Roboto", Sans-serif;font-size:20px;font-weight:400;width:var( --container-widget-width, 27.813vw );max-width:27.813vw;--container-widget-width:27.813vw;--container-widget-flex-grow:0;}.elementor-9 .elementor-element.elementor-element-0e20012 > .elementor-widget-container{margin:0px 0px 0px -40px;}.elementor-9 .elementor-element.elementor-element-0e20012.elementor-element{--flex-grow:0;--flex-shrink:0;}@media(min-width:768px){.elementor-9 .elementor-element.elementor-element-2c40e02{width:50%;}.elementor-9 .elementor-element.elementor-element-4d51bb2{width:50%;}}@media(max-width:1024px){.elementor-9 .elementor-element.elementor-element-2c40e02 > .elementor-element-populated{padding:125px 10px 150px 10px;}.elementor-9 .elementor-element.elementor-element-c3fcf27 .elementor-heading-title{font-size:3.8vw;}}@media(max-width:767px){.elementor-9 .elementor-element.elementor-element-2c40e02 > .elementor-element-populated{padding:75px 15px 100px 15px;}.elementor-9 .elementor-element.elementor-element-c3fcf27 .elementor-heading-title{font-size:30px;}.elementor-9 .elementor-element.elementor-element-53da6b7{--spacer-size:10px;}.elementor-9 .elementor-element.elementor-element-49952ac{width:100%;max-width:100%;}}/* Start custom CSS for text-editor, class: .elementor-element-49952ac */.ct-woo-unauthorized>.woocommerce-form-login button[type=submit], .ct-woo-unauthorized>.woocommerce-ResetPassword button[type=submit] {
    margin-top: 15px !important;
}

button#wpua-upload-existing, input#submit, button#wpua-add-existing, button#wpua-undo-existing, a.woocommerce-Button.wc-forward.button {
    background: transparent;
    border: 1px solid #8888;
    border-radius: 6px;
}

code {
    background: transparent!important;
    /* border: 1px solid #333; */
    border-bottom: 1px solid #333!important;
}/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-2c40e02 */.signup-call .elementor-widget-wrap.elementor-element-populated {
    display: grid !important;
}
@media (max-width: 600px) {
.elementor-9 .elementor-element.elementor-element-ad32e9f, .elementor-9 .elementor-element.elementor-element-69df920 {
 width: 100% !important;
    
}

.signup-call .elementor-widget-wrap.elementor-element-populated {
     padding: 75px 15px 150px 15px !important;
     display:flex !important;
}
}
 @media (min-width: 2000px) {
     
     .signup-call {
    padding-left: 12vw ; 
  }
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-70c933d */.titulo-chamada {
    max-width: 800px !important;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-49952ac */.ct-woo-unauthorized>.woocommerce-form-login button[type=submit], .ct-woo-unauthorized>.woocommerce-ResetPassword button[type=submit] {
    margin-top: 15px !important;
}

button#wpua-upload-existing, input#submit, button#wpua-add-existing, button#wpua-undo-existing, a.woocommerce-Button.wc-forward.button {
    background: transparent;
    border: 1px solid #8888;
    border-radius: 6px;
}

code {
    background: transparent!important;
    /* border: 1px solid #333; */
    border-bottom: 1px solid #333!important;
}/* End custom CSS */
/* Start custom CSS for column, class: .elementor-element-2c40e02 */.signup-call .elementor-widget-wrap.elementor-element-populated {
    display: grid !important;
}
@media (max-width: 600px) {
.elementor-9 .elementor-element.elementor-element-ad32e9f, .elementor-9 .elementor-element.elementor-element-69df920 {
 width: 100% !important;
    
}

.signup-call .elementor-widget-wrap.elementor-element-populated {
     padding: 75px 15px 150px 15px !important;
     display:flex !important;
}
}
 @media (min-width: 2000px) {
     
     .signup-call {
    padding-left: 12vw ; 
  }
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-70c933d */.titulo-chamada {
    max-width: 800px !important;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-6f13b63 */.woocommerce-MyAccount-content fieldset {
        border: 1px solid #6a6a6a6b;
}/* End custom CSS */
/* Start custom CSS for text-editor, class: .elementor-element-6f13b63 */.woocommerce-MyAccount-content fieldset {
        border: 1px solid #6a6a6a6b;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-b2fc3ad */button#wpua-remove-existing {
    border-radius: 6px;
    border: 1px solid #333;
    background: black;
}

div.nsl-container .nsl-button-default div.nsl-button-label-container {    
     color:#1e1e1e;
     
}

p.form-row {
    margin-bottom: -5px;
}


div.nsl-container[data-align="left"] {
    text-align: center !important;
        width: 100%;
}
div#social-login-container {
    align-items: center!important;
}

.e-con-boxed.e-flex {
 align-items: center !important;
}
 .no-account {
     margin-top: 3px;
     font-size: 14px ;
 }
 
 .no-account a {
    color: #59c7ff;
 }

    form.woocommerce-EditAccountForm.edit-account {
        max-width: 800px;
    }
    
   li.woocommerce-MyAccount-navigation-link.woocommerce-MyAccount-navigation-link--edit-address.is-active,  li.woocommerce-MyAccount-navigation-link.woocommerce-MyAccount-navigation-link--edit-address, li.woocommerce-MyAccount-navigation-link.woocommerce-MyAccount-navigation-link--wishlist,li.woocommerce-MyAccount-navigation-link.woocommerce-MyAccount-navigation-link--downloads  {
       display: none!important;
   }
   
   .ct-acount-nav {
    min-width: 300px;
    border: 1px solid #222;
}

li.woocommerce-MyAccount-navigation-link .dashicons {
    float: right !important;
    margin-right: 2px !important;
    margin-top: -2px;
    scale: 1.2;
}

p.wcmtx_icon_src span.dashicons.dashicons-bell {
    width: 40px;
    height: 40px;
}

li.dashicons.dashicons-bell {
    width: 40px;
    height: 40px;
}

p.wcmtx_icon_src .dashicons::before {
    display: inline-block;
    content: '';
    width: 35px; /* Largura da imagem */
    height: 40px; /* Altura da imagem */
    background-image: url('https://bitcoincounterflow.com/wp-content/uploads/2024/08/alert-add-svgrepo-com.png');
    background-size: contain;
    background-repeat: no-repeat;
    vertical-align: middle; /* Alinhamento vertical */
    
}

li .dashicons::before { 
    content: '';
    display: inline-block;
    width: 20px; /* Largura da imagem */
    height: 16px; /* Altura da imagem */
    background-image: url('https://bitcoincounterflow.com/wp-content/uploads/2024/08/alert-add-svgrepo-com.png');
    background-size: contain;
    background-repeat: no-repeat;
    vertical-align: middle; /* Alinhamento vertical */
}

section.elementor-section.elementor-top-section.elementor-element.elementor-element-1a34468.ct-section-stretched.elementor-section-full_width.elementor-section-height-default.elementor-section-height-default.wpr-particle-no.wpr-jarallax-no.wpr-parallax-no.wpr-sticky-section-no {
	display:none;
}

.elementor-element.elementor-element-6bc83d0.e-con-full.e-flex.wpr-particle-no.wpr-jarallax-no.wpr-parallax-no.wpr-sticky-section-no.e-con.e-parent.e-lazyloaded {
    display: none !important;
}



.wcmtx-my-account-links.wcmtx-grid a {
    background: black;
    border-radius: 5px;
    border: 1px solid #222;
}

body {
    background: #030303;
}

main .woocommerce.ct-woo-account {
        max-width: 1400px;
}

.container-alert, .alarms-container {
    border: 1px solid #222;
    background: black !important;
}


p.woocommerce-LostPassword.lost_password {
    position: relative;
    bottom: -55px;
}

footer {
    margin-top:70px;
}

.nsl-button.nsl-button-default.nsl-button-google {
    margin-top: -20px;
    border-radius: 2px !important;
    margin-bottom: 13px;
       max-width: 100%;
}


p.woocommerce-LostPassword.lost_password {
    z-index: 5;
}

/* Estilo para dispositivos móveis */
@media only screen and (max-width: 767px) {
    .nsl-container-buttons,
    .nsl-button.nsl-button-default.nsl-button-google,
    .nsl-button.nsl-button-default.nsl-button-google {
        min-width: 100%;
        margin-top: -25px;
    }
    
    .elementor-element.elementor-element-6b1a8e1.elementor-widget__width-auto.pa-display-conditions-yes.elementor-widget.elementor-widget-shortcode {
        width: 100%;
    }
}

.elementor-container.elementor-column-gap-default {
    margin-bottom: -70px;
}



footer {
    margin-top:70px;
}


    .elementor-element.elementor-element-d6d8b3e.pa-display-conditions-yes.e-flex.e-con-boxed.wpr-particle-no.wpr-jarallax-no.wpr-parallax-no.wpr-sticky-section-no.e-con.e-parent {
        height: 15px;
    }
    
    .e-con-inner {
        display: none;
    }
    
    div.e-con-inner {
        margin: 0 10px;
    width: 95% !important;
    }
    
    .elementor-element.elementor-element-03f69ff.e-flex.e-con-boxed.wpr-particle-no.wpr-jarallax-no.wpr-parallax-no.wpr-sticky-section-no.e-con.e-parent {
    display: none!important;
    margin-top: 20px;
}

p.woocommerce-form-row.woocommerce-form-row--wide.form-row.form-row-wide {
    margin-bottom: 10px;
}/* End custom CSS */